Giant Explore E+ 4 Stagger
Specifications
MotorGiant SyncDrive Sport2, 75Nm PedalPlus 6-sensor technology
ControllerGiant RideControl Dash 2, Smart Assist automatic mode, 5 support levels
DisplayGiant RideControl Dash 2 high-angle visibility, full color LCD display
BatteryGiant EnergyPak Smart 500Wh, Aluminium casing with highest safety standard (EN50604), CO2 Neutral production
ChargerGiant EnergyPak 4A smart charger compact, 60% charge in 2:30h
ConnectivityGiant RideControl App enabled ANT+ wireless display signal with e-bike profile
FrameALUXX-grade aluminum, gen. 3, 1.8" - 1.5" head tube, integrated battery, KSA40 kickstand mount
ForkSR Suntour XCM34 Boost DS, 100mm, 15x110mm AH thru-axle
HandlebarGiant Connect Riser 31.8
Grips Giant Contact Ergo
Stem Giant Contact
SeatpostGiant forged alloy, 30.9mm, 2-bolt micro adjustable
SaddleSelle Royal Vivo Ergo Unisex
PedalsAnti-slip
ShiftersShimano CUES, 1x9
Rear Derailleur Shimano CUES RD-U4020
BrakesTektro HD-M275, hydraulic Tektro TR-52 rotors, [F] 180mm, [R] 180mm
Brake LeversTektro HD-M280
Cassette Shimano CUES, 9-speed, 11-36
ChainShimano LinkGlide, LG500
CranksetForged alloy, direct spider/chain guard 46t steel narrow/wide chain ring
RimsGiant eX25, alloy, tubeless ready, 622x25
HubsGiant eTracker, [F] 110x15mm thru-axle, [R] 148x12mm thru-axle
SpokesStainless
TiresGiant Crosscut Gravel 2, tubeless, 700x57c, 60TPI, wire bead, puncture protect
ExtrasABUS Xplus battery lock, [F] Giant Recon E HL50 StZVO light, [R] Axa NYX 6 light, KSA40 direct mount kickstand, alloy MIK rear carrier, alloy fenders Optional: Giant Recon series e-bike lights available and direct connectable
Geometry
| S | M | L |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| A | Reach | 383 | 401 | 416 |
| B | Stack | 609 | 618 | 633 |
| C | Head Tube Angle | 69.5° | 69.5° | 69.5° |
| D | Bottom Bracket Drop | 60 | 60 | 60 |
| E | Wheelbase | 1112 | 1121 | 1142 |
| F | Chain Stay Length | 455 | 455 | 455 |
| G | Head Tube Length | 130 | 140 | 155 |
| H | Top Tube Length | 570 | 590 | 610 |
| I | Seat Tube Angle | 73.0° | 73.0° | 73.0° |
| J | Standover Height | 682 | 676 | 665 |
| All measurements in degrees or millimetres | ||||
Sizing Guide
The sizing chart is a great place to start when picking your next bike but everyone will fit a bike a bit differently. Your torso, arm, and leg lengths all play into what size of bike you may need. Plus, there's your own personal preference.
